This will be crucial in keeping targets in place as you slash them down in quick succession. Razor Claw, in particular, adds a slow effect to targets each time you hit them with a move. Muscle Band, Scope Lens, and Razor Claw should provide all the damage you need to burst down targets when executing Night Slash Attacks. The best approach is to disable targets first with Shadow Claw before performing combos. The key to this build is hitting all of Night Slash's activations, particularly the final AOE damage since that'll deal the highest burst damage. This is a full-damage build centered on bursting targets down with Night Slash and Shadow Claw. Lastly, Focus Band increases your defenses and gives you survivability when you dash around and attack targets. Razor Claw can trap targets in place with extra slow effects, making it easy for you to land attacks. Getting the maximum bonus, especially in the early game, allows you to deal high amounts of damage when you perform combos.

The build also takes advantage of the mobility provided by Zoroark's moves to get extra stats from score-related items.Īttack Weight boosts Zoroark's attack stat each time you score a goal (up to 6 times). You can be flexible with choosing your other move, depending on the effect you prefer - if you want HP recovery, learn Cut or if you prefer crowd control, learn Shadow Claw instead. This is a hit-and-run build that utilizes Feint Attack's mobility and move reset mechanic to make Zoroark hard to hit while it pressures opponents.
